Seb Fontaine, UK-born DJ, gained fame with Radio 1 and Global Underground. Known for his residencies at Cream and Ministry of Sound, he shifted from rare groove to progressive house in the '90s.
Todd Terry, born in Brooklyn, defined 1980s New York house music by blending disco, Chicago house, and hip-hop. Known for hits "Missing" remix, "Keep on Jumpin'," and "Something Goin' On," he collaborated with the Jungle Brothers and remixed artists like Björk and Janet Jackson. Terry founded Freeze Records and influenced U.K. rave. His collaborations span Kevin Saunderson to House Gospel Choir.
Danny Rampling, born in Streatham, London, is a seminal DJ in the British house scene, known for introducing Balearic beats. Founder of Shoom and Pure club nights, he helped pioneer early rave culture alongside Paul Oakenfold and others. Rampling hosted Radio 1's Love Groove Dance Party and released mix albums with Metropole, Mixmag, and Virgin. Despite a brief setback in 1997, he returned strong with Club Nation in 1998.
Tall Paul is a UK music icon known for energizing dancefloors worldwide. Starting at Turnmills, he's a pioneer of London's pirate radio scene and held a Trade residency. He played major venues like Ministry of Sound and Cream and gained international fame with sets across the U.S., Ibiza, and beyond.
